Job Description

Extractions Lab Technician - Laboratory Operations- Indianapolis, IN

We are seeking a self-motivated, Full-Time Extractions Lab Technician to join our Laboratory Operations team. Under the supervision of a Laboratory Manager, the Extractions Technician is responsible for preparing biological specimens for analysis using confirmation instrument technology. This includes handling urine and oral fluid specimens, performing sample preparation and extraction of analytes, and maintaining strict adherence to chain of custody documentation.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Aliquot urine and/or oral fluid specimens for sample preparation procedures
  • Perform sample preparation techniques including specimen hydrolysis, solid phase extraction, and liquid-liquid extraction in accordance with laboratory SOPs
  • Prepare samples for liquid chromatography tandem mass spectrometry (LC/MS-MS) analysis
  • Prepare and restock reagents and buffers as needed
  • Assist with maintaining adequate inventory of laboratory supplies
  • Troubleshoot issues as necessary and escalate when appropriate
  • Maintain accurate records associated with specimen preparation and chain of custody
  • Perform other duties as assigned, consistent with education, training, and abilities

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in a science-related field required (Chemistry, Biochemistry, Biology, Microbiology, Biomedical/Pre-Med, Forensics, or Toxicology)
  • Laboratory experience preferred
  • Data entry skills (alpha and numeric keyboarding) required
  • Strong hand-eye coordination required
  • Ability to work in a high-volume environment while maintaining a high level of quality and accuracy required
